We've been successfully using LDAP authentication for some years now. This year we wanted to look at whether there was a good way for users to be automatically enrolled on certain courses, and we came across the LDAP enrolment plugin.

We think we've got it set up properly, but when we go to enable LDAP enrolment on a course that we want to test it on, it does not appear in the list of enrolment plugins we can add.


Does anyone have any suggestions why this might be or how we can troubleshoot this?

It sounds as though the person attempting to enable LDAP enrolment on a course does not have a role with the capability enrol/ldap:manage allowed. It's not allowed for the default teacher role, only the manager role.
